What it means

AI search optimisation makes your business easier to retrieve and represent.

People increasingly ask complete questions and receive summarised answers, recommendations and cited sources. The opportunity is to provide information that machines can access, interpret and support with credible evidence.

It is

  • Clear and consistent information about your brand and expertise
  • Useful answers shaped around real customer questions
  • Technically accessible pages with explicit structure
  • Authority earned through relevant mentions and citations
  • Measurement across changing discovery experiences

It is not

  • A guaranteed place in a ChatGPT response
  • Hidden text written for machines rather than customers
  • Schema markup applied without accurate visible content
  • Thousands of generic AI-written articles
  • A reason to abandon proven SEO foundations
The practical principleAI systems decide what they retrieve and generate. Optimisation improves the clarity and credibility of the available evidence; it cannot control a third-party answer.

SEO, AEO and GEO

Different emphasis. Shared foundations.

The labels help describe changing discovery formats, but they should work as one connected strategy rather than three competing services.

DisciplinePrimary focusTypical outcomeShared foundations
SEOVisibility in organic search resultsRanked pages, traffic and qualified actionsTechnical access, useful content, clear entities, authority, relevance and trustworthy evidence
AEODirect answers and answer surfacesFeatured answers, voice responses and concise retrieval
GEORepresentation within generative responsesMentions, citations and inclusion in AI-generated answers

Good SEO helps machines discover and evaluate your pages. Answer-led content makes useful passages easier to retrieve. Entity clarity and external corroboration help systems understand who the information is about and why it deserves confidence.

Common questions

A clearer view of AI visibility.

Start with what customers need to understand and the evidence available to support the answer.

What is AI search optimisation?

It improves the clarity, structure, usefulness and credibility of information about a business so AI-powered discovery tools can more readily understand, retrieve and reference it.

Is this different from SEO?

It extends rather than replaces SEO. Technical access, relevant content and authority still matter. AI optimisation adds emphasis on entities, answer structure, factual consistency, citations and visibility beyond conventional rankings.

Can you guarantee a mention in ChatGPT or Google AI Overviews?

No. These platforms control their retrieval, ranking and generated responses. Responsible optimisation strengthens the evidence and signals available to them without claiming control over a third-party answer.

What does an AI visibility assessment include?

Depending on scope, it can review priority prompts, current mentions, cited sources, competitor representation, entity clarity, answer coverage, structured data, technical access and external authority before setting priorities.

Does structured data guarantee AI visibility?

No. Structured data makes certain information more explicit, but it needs accurate visible content and strong technical and authority foundations. It is one useful signal, not a shortcut.

Which AI platforms can be considered?

The relevant set may include ChatGPT, Google AI Overviews or AI Mode, Gemini and other discovery experiences used by your audience. Platform coverage should follow customer behaviour rather than a fixed tool list.
